co.dev is an AI-powered platform that transforms plain-English descriptions of app concepts into full-stack, production-ready web applications. Using technologies like Next.js for the front end and Supabase (with Prisma) for real-time backend functionality, it enables both developers and non-developers to swiftly build, customize, and deploy scalable web apps. With co.dev, users retain full ownership of the generated source code, avoiding vendor lock-in and enabling ongoing development outside the platform. It supports features like authentication modules, database integration, one-click domain setup, and SSL provisioning, making rapid app development accessible and seamless.

TryMirai is an on-device AI infrastructure platform that enables developers to integrate high-performance AI models directly into their apps with minimal latency, full data privacy, and no inference costs. The platform includes an optimized library of models (ranging in parameter sizes such as 0.3B, 0.5B, 1B, 3B, and 7B) to match different business goals, ensuring both efficiency and adaptability. It offers a smart routing engine to balance performance, privacy, and cost, and tools like SDKs for Apple platforms (with upcoming support for Android) to simplify integration. Users can deploy AI capabilities—such as summarization, classification, general chat, and custom use cases—without relying on cloud offloading, which reduces dependencies on network connectivity and protects user data.

Powerdrill AI is an advanced, no-code data analysis platform that enables users—across business, academic, or technical domains—to upload datasets, ask natural-language questions, generate reports and visualizations, and extract actionable insights quickly. Built for speed and accessibility, the platform supports multiple file types (CSV, Excel, PDF, TSV), database connections and conversational interfaces, making it possible to move from raw data to insight without requiring data-science skills. According to its documentation, users can upload spreadsheets, merge datasets, remove duplicates, generate professional-grade reports, select visualisations, conduct exploratory data analysis and share insights with teams.

Qoder is an agentic coding platform that powers real software development with AI agents handling complex tasks like code generation, testing, refactoring, and debugging across 200+ languages. It features NES intelligent suggestions, Quest mode for autonomous multi-file work, inline chats, codebase wikis, persistent memory learning, and MCP tool integration for external services. Downloadable for Windows, Mac, and Linux, it combines multi-model AI (Claude, GPT, Gemini) with deep context engineering for precise, iterative coding support.
